Parents always want the best for their kids. But everyone has their own way of parenting(养育). Here are some popular parenting styles. Which one do you like best?
Tiger parents(虎爸虎妈) They are strict with their children. They want them to get the best grades in their class. They love their kids in their hearts. | Dolphin parents(海豚式父母) They just want their kids to be happy and healthy. They make sure their kids get enough sleep and exercise. |
Helicopter parents(直升机式父母) They worry too much about their children and "fly" over them like helicopters. Many people think these parents should give their children more freedom(自由). | Lawnmower parents(割草机式父母) Like a lawnmower that cuts grass, they get rid of(去除) all difficulties for their children. Their kids never learn to work out problems on their own. |

I moved from Munich to Berlin last month, and now I’m a student at Handel School. I like the school, but I don’t have any new friends here. I tried to talk to my classmates after the bell rang at the end of class, but nobody said much to me. Well, one person did. She told me that I could not wear a sweatshirt(运动衫)over my uniform. I am really friendly, and want to make new friends. But I don’t know what to do. Please help me!.
Kate
Dear Kate,
I’m happy that you wrote to me. Here are some ideas to help you make friends. First, don’t talk much to your classmates after the bell rings. Most people must go quickly to their next lesson. They don’t have time to talk. You can sit with your classmates when having lunch. Then they have more time to talk to you. Or, go to the playground during the break. Find people doing something that is interesting to you and talk to them. People having the same interest are easy to be friends.
Good luck!
Help Me Hal

Parents like to share children’s photos in social medias. Some children think parents should respect children’s privacy. But others think it’s a way to show parents’ love.
Qian Bosi, 14
Parents should respect and protect their children’s privacy (隐私). Photos can show their kids’faces, places they’ve been to and other information. In these cases, parents can accidentally violate (侵犯) their kids’ privacy when sharing photos online. It’s not safe. Some people might use the photos for bad things. It’s hard to imagine what could happen. Parents should be more careful about this. Li Meiying, 14
Some parents like to share embarrassing photos of their kids online. For example, sometimes their kids are sleeping or crying in their pictures. But most kids don’t want these photos to be shared online. They may not care when they are little babies, but as they grow up, they might be upset about it. So to avoid hurting their children’s feelings, parents should ask for permission (允许) from their kids before sharing their photos online. He Meixi, 14
In my opinion, there’s nothing wrong about parents posting pictures of their babies online. It shows that they love their children – they just want to share pictures of their kids with their friends. It’s a convenient way for relatives who live far away to stay in touch with their family. And when these children grow up, they can find these pictures online and relive their childhood.
